Internal medicine Alaska expert witnesses, profiled in this directory, may consult on alleged errors in diagnosis (incorrect diagnosis or delayed diagnosis), errors in performance of procedures, breach of care, failure to monitor subordinates, incorrect prescriptions or incorrect administration of medicines, lack of informed consent and related matters. These internists may provide expert witness opinions on matters involving internal organs, the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ases, including issues of preventative medicine, obesity, men's health, women's health, and related matters.- United States
